How to Play Logo Quiz Master

Try Logo Quiz Master and enjoy hours of fun!

Controls

Guess the correct logo from the given options. Click or tap the right answer to win the level. Complete all levels to become the logo quiz master! Controls: Use your mouse or finger to select the correct logo.
